Wasp Dagger Grind+ LATAMA Bayonet
Hi again , I thought I'd post both my wasps together so you can check the differences. The locking tabs are quite different as is the firing button is a little
larger on the Latama. The Latama back spring is the typical 5mm but the mystery knife is 4mm. Hope you like.

Wasp Dagger grind
Hi everyone, I found this little beauty recently. Its similar to the Latama wasp body however it has Lock tab like the Frosolone, the spring also has a curve cut into in so it misses the sear when closing.
